The Shops at Willow Bend
Plano, TX
Location
This two-level finely crafted, enclosed Prairie-style shopping mall is located just north of the Dallas city line. It is at the northwest intersection of the Dallas North Tollway and West Park Boulevard. The Shops at Willow Bend is half of a mile north of the President George Bush Turnpike which provides a direct route to Dallas-Ft. Worth International Airport. The center is also easily accessible from the LBJ Freeway.
Anchored by
Neiman Marcus, Crate & Barrel, Macy's, and Dillard's

Shopper Characteristics
The Willow Bend trade area enjoys high, double-income households and three major corridors of exceptional technological and office development growth. 76% of shoppers at Willow Bend are married and 45% have children under 18 at home. 92% have attended college or graduate school and 69% are white-collar professionals.
Willow Bend shoppers are twice as likely to have an annual household income in excess of $100,000 than the average adult in the Dallas/Fort Worth/Arlington DMA.
